Struggling Phillies place catcher J.T. Realmuto on the 10-day IL with back spasms

CHICAGO (AP) 鈥 The struggling Philadelphia Phillies placed catcher J.T. Realmuto on the 10-day injured list Wednesday because of back spasms.

Realmuto left to Atlanta with lower back tightness. He returned to the lineup Tuesday night against the Chicago Cubs, but his back started bothering him again.

鈥淗e’s sore, and it’s going to be a few days before he’s pain-free,鈥 manager Rob Thomson said. 鈥淪o that’s why we decided to put him on the IL. It’s just some inflammation. We think he’s going to be back at the 10-day mark.鈥

After making the IL move with Realmuto, the Phillies struck out 12 times and failed to draw a walk in to the Cubs. It was the team’s eighth consecutive loss in the franchise鈥檚 longest skid since dropping nine in a row in September 2018.

鈥淲e got a long way to go,鈥 Thomson said. 鈥淚 think there’s a lot of frustration here, but, at the same time, these guys know that we got a talented group. Not much is going right for us right now, and at times we’re not playing well. We just got to stay after it and keep fighting.鈥

The Phillies brought up catcher Garrett Stubbs from Triple-A Lehigh Valley before Wednesday’s game. Right-hander Max Lazar, who is coming back from an oblique strain, was transferred to the 60-day IL.

The 35-year-old Realmuto is batting .259 with a homer and four RBIs in 17 games. The three-time All-Star re-signed with Philadelphia in free agency, agreeing to in January.

Realmuto joins a crowded injured list that also includes closer Jhoan Duran (oblique strain), right-hander Zack Wheeler (shoulder surgery) and reliever Zach Pop (calf strain).

鈥淲e’ve had this in the past,鈥 Thomson said, 鈥渁nd it’s time for guys to step up and I expect that and that’s why you have depth and we’ve got depth. Stubby will come in here and he’s played a lot of meaningful baseball here in Philadelphia, so I feel good about that.鈥

Lefty reliever Jos茅 Alvarado left Tuesday’s game at Wrigley Field because of a back spasm. But Alvarado threw on flat ground Wednesday, and Thomson thought he would be fine.

Duran, who was acquired in a trade with Minnesota in July, is playing catch and feeling better, Thomson said.
